I went here for lunch today with my son and couldn't have wished for a better experience. The chap behind the bar was very friendly. We ordered our food and drink... I had southern fried chicken wrap and a (very) large hot chocolate and my son had the veggie all day breakfast and a pint of diet coke. There was some sort of lunch deal on and it came to around £14.60 which I thought was good. The food came out in roughly ten minutes and was amazing! There was a relaxed atmosphere here with soft music playing. Thete are various tv screens around showing sport but no volume.We had nearly opted for one of the trendy coffee shops down the Gloucester road but I'm so glad we decided on here. I'll definately go back. I'd like to try some of the big choice of ciders there too at some point. I was particularly impressed that they have a no straw rule reducing.plastic waste too.
